The server implements the principle of doing the least as needed. As a result
it is extremely lightweight with the fact it doesn't attempt to re-implement
much of it's functions internally but will instead rely on external
applications that already implement the functions very well.
It doesn't have a builtin user interface so instead external applications are
more than welcome to interface with the buffer/footage directories to

JustMotion-Client is the client portion of this application that actually
implement a user interface. Utilizing the same principle of doing the least as

needed, it uses an external video player to play m3u8 playlist files located
at the server's buffer/footage directories. It mounts the server as an ssh
filesystem to access such directories so no need to open any addtional ports
if your server already has working ssh access.
